    Fee Structure Overview

    The total fee for the four-year Pharmacy program at Manav Rachna University Faridabad is ₹350,000. This includes tuition fees, hostel rent, mess charges, and other mandatory components. The fee structure is designed to be transparent and affordable, with provisions for financial assistance through various scholarship schemes.

    Detailed Fee Components

    The fee structure is divided into several components to ensure that students receive value for every rupee invested:

    • Tuition Fee: Covers instruction, laboratory access, and academic resources.
    • Hostel Rent: Includes accommodation in well-maintained hostels with basic amenities.
    • Mess Advance: Provides meals at subsidized rates with varied dietary options.
    • Student Benevolent Fund: Supports students from economically disadvantaged backgrounds.
    • Medical Fees: Covers basic healthcare services provided by the university clinic.
    • Gymkhana Fees: Funds extracurricular activities and sports facilities.
    • Examination Fees: Covers administrative costs related to exams, grades, and transcripts.

    Hostel & Mess Charges

    Students have access to comfortable hostel accommodations with modern amenities:

    • Room Types: Single occupancy rooms with basic furniture and Wi-Fi connectivity.
    • Mess Billing System: Monthly mess bills are calculated based on actual consumption, with options for advance payment or installment plans.
    • Rebate Policies: Students can avail rebates during examination periods and holidays, reducing monthly charges.

    The university ensures that hostel facilities meet hygiene standards and provide a safe environment conducive to academic excellence.

    Fee Waivers, Concessions, and Scholarships

    Manav Rachna University offers various financial aid options to deserving students:

    • SC/ST/PwD Category: 100% fee waiver for eligible students based on income slabs.
    • EWS Category: 50% fee concession for families with annual income below ₹3 lakh.
    • MCM (Minority Community): 25% fee discount for students from minority communities.

    Applications for financial aid must be submitted along with supporting documents, including income certificates and caste certificates. The university reviews applications annually and disburses benefits accordingly.

    Payment Procedures & Refund Policy

    Students are required to make payments within the specified deadlines to avoid late fees:

    • Payment Deadlines: Semesters begin on July 15th, with fees due by August 10th.
    • Late Fee Calculation: ₹500 per day beyond the deadline, capped at ₹5,000.
    • Refund Rules: Refunds are processed only in case of withdrawal or cancellation before the start of the semester. Requests must be submitted in writing with valid reasons and supporting documentation.

    The university accepts payments via online banking, NEFT/RTGS, credit/debit cards, and cash deposits at designated counters. A receipt is generated for each transaction to maintain transparency.
